rsa-java-js:spring-boot的一个Demo项目,涉及javascript加密和java解密

上传者: 42131728 | 上传时间: 2023-02-11 21:30:59 | 文件大小: 144KB | 文件类型: ZIP
## Introduction spring-boot的一个演示项目,涉及rsa javascript加密和java解密。 ##基本环境###后端 Java 8 Gradle2.5或更高 ###前端 npm 吞咽 ###技能 RSA 弹簧靴 ##运行应用程序### 1。 安装前端$ npm install $ gulp ### 2。 启动服务器 同一域 $ gradle clean bootRun Cors域 $ gradle clean build $ java -jar -Dserver.port=8099 build/libs/rsa-java-js-1.0-SNAPSHOT.jar $ java -jar -Dserver.port=8088 build/libs/rsa-java-js-1.0-SNAPSHOT.jar ##参考 Spring启动

文件下载

资源详情

[{"title":"( 39 个子文件 144KB ) rsa-java-js:spring-boot的一个Demo项目,涉及javascript加密和java解密","children":[{"title":"rsa-java-js-master","children":[{"title":".gitignore <span style='color:#111;'> 248B </span>","children":null,"spread":false},{"title":"gradle","children":[{"title":"wrapper","children":[{"title":"gradle-wrapper.jar <span style='color:#111;'> 49.81KB </span>","children":null,"spread":false},{"title":"gradle-wrapper.properties <span style='color:#111;'> 230B </span>","children":null,"spread":false}],"spread":true}],"spread":true},{"title":"README.md <span style='color:#111;'> 10.16KB </span>","children":null,"spread":false},{"title":"build.gradle <span style='color:#111;'> 1.51KB </span>","children":null,"spread":false},{"title":"gradlew.bat <span style='color:#111;'> 2.35KB </span>","children":null,"spread":false},{"title":"gradlew <span style='color:#111;'> 4.96KB </span>","children":null,"spread":false},{"title":"bower.json <span style='color:#111;'> 405B </span>","children":null,"spread":false},{"title":"package.json <span style='color:#111;'> 933B </span>","children":null,"spread":false},{"title":"rsa-java-js.iml <span style='color:#111;'> 9.53KB </span>","children":null,"spread":false},{"title":"src","children":[{"title":"test","children":[{"title":"java","children":[{"title":"org","children":[{"title":"yood","children":[{"title":"rsa","children":[{"title":"web","children":[{"title":"controller","children":[{"title":"EncryptionControllerTest.java <span style='color:#111;'> 3.07KB </span>","children":null,"spread":false}],"spread":false}],"spread":false},{"title":"util","children":[{"title":"RSAUtilsTest.java <span style='color:#111;'> 4.80KB </span>","children":null,"spread":false}],"spread":false}],"spread":false}],"spread":false}],"spread":true}],"spread":true}],"spread":true},{"title":"main","children":[{"title":"resources","children":[{"title":"static","children":[{"title":"css","children":[{"title":"bootstrap.min.css <span style='color:#111;'> 115.74KB </span>","children":null,"spread":false}],"spread":false},{"title":"js","children":[{"title":"main.min.js <span style='color:#111;'> 135.83KB </span>","children":null,"spread":false},{"title":"encryption.js <span style='color:#111;'> 2.73KB </span>","children":null,"spread":false}],"spread":false}],"spread":false},{"title":"logback.xml <span style='color:#111;'> 1.47KB </span>","children":null,"spread":false},{"title":"templates","children":[{"title":"error.html <span style='color:#111;'> 1.02KB </span>","children":null,"spread":false},{"title":"encryption.html <span style='color:#111;'> 850B </span>","children":null,"spread":false},{"title":"home.html <span style='color:#111;'> 841B </span>","children":null,"spread":false},{"title":"login.html <span style='color:#111;'> 1.21KB </span>","children":null,"spread":false}],"spread":false},{"title":"application.properties <span style='color:#111;'> 137B </span>","children":null,"spread":false}],"spread":true},{"title":"java","children":[{"title":"org","children":[{"title":"yood","children":[{"title":"rsa","children":[{"title":"RSAApplication.java <span style='color:#111;'> 555B </span>","children":null,"spread":false},{"title":"web","children":[{"title":"validator","children":[{"title":"UserValidator.java <span style='color:#111;'> 1.33KB </span>","children":null,"spread":false},{"title":"GenericValidator.java <span style='color:#111;'> 547B </span>","children":null,"spread":false}],"spread":false},{"title":"exception","children":[{"title":"ExceptionCode.java <span style='color:#111;'> 541B </span>","children":null,"spread":false},{"title":"BusinessException.java <span style='color:#111;'> 814B </span>","children":null,"spread":false},{"title":"UnAuthorizedException.java <span style='color:#111;'> 530B </span>","children":null,"spread":false},{"title":"ExceptionBody.java <span style='color:#111;'> 558B </span>","children":null,"spread":false},{"title":"GlobalExceptionHandlerControllerAdvice.java <span style='color:#111;'> 1.34KB </span>","children":null,"spread":false}],"spread":false},{"title":"controller","children":[{"title":"LoginController.java <span style='color:#111;'> 752B </span>","children":null,"spread":false},{"title":"EncryptionController.java <span style='color:#111;'> 1.96KB </span>","children":null,"spread":false}],"spread":false},{"title":"filter","children":[{"title":"CORSFilter.java <span style='color:#111;'> 1.49KB </span>","children":null,"spread":false}],"spread":false}],"spread":false},{"title":"config","children":[{"title":"WebMvcConfig.java <span style='color:#111;'> 889B </span>","children":null,"spread":false}],"spread":false},{"title":"entity","children":[{"title":"User.java <span style='color:#111;'> 1.48KB </span>","children":null,"spread":false},{"title":"Authority.java <span style='color:#111;'> 689B </span>","children":null,"spread":false}],"spread":false},{"title":"util","children":[{"title":"JSONUtils.java <span style='color:#111;'> 404B </span>","children":null,"spread":false},{"title":"RSAUtils.java <span style='color:#111;'> 5.21KB </span>","children":null,"spread":false}],"spread":false}],"spread":false}],"spread":false}],"spread":false}],"spread":false}],"spread":true}],"spread":true},{"title":"settings.gradle <span style='color:#111;'> 34B </span>","children":null,"spread":false},{"title":"gulpfile.js <span style='color:#111;'> 1.06KB </span>","children":null,"spread":false}],"spread":false}],"spread":true}]

评论信息

免责申明

【只为小站】的资源来自网友分享,仅供学习研究,请务必在下载后24小时内给予删除,不得用于其他任何用途,否则后果自负。基于互联网的特殊性,【只为小站】 无法对用户传输的作品、信息、内容的权属或合法性、合规性、真实性、科学性、完整权、有效性等进行实质审查;无论 【只为小站】 经营者是否已进行审查,用户均应自行承担因其传输的作品、信息、内容而可能或已经产生的侵权或权属纠纷等法律责任。
本站所有资源不代表本站的观点或立场,基于网友分享,根据中国法律《信息网络传播权保护条例》第二十二条之规定,若资源存在侵权或相关问题请联系本站客服人员,zhiweidada#qq.com,请把#换成@,本站将给予最大的支持与配合,做到及时反馈和处理。关于更多版权及免责申明参见 版权及免责申明